CONTENT DISTRIBUTION SYSTEM AND METHOD |
摘要 |
There are described methods and systems for distributing content in a network, in particular a multicast network. One method includes delivering content from a source to a destination in a content delivery network. A request for an item of content is received and a first multicast stream is identified or established, the first multicast stream comprising a first copy of the content. At least one second multicast stream is also identified or established, the second stream comprising a second copy of the content. The second copy of the content is time-shifted by a time, M, from corresponding portions of the first copy of the content. The content is then delivered to the destination using both the first and the second multicast streams. |

主权项 |
1. A method of delivering content from a source to at least one destination in a content delivery network, the method comprising:
receiving a request for delivery of a piece of content to the destination; receiving information relating to a capability of the destination; determining whether the content should be delivered in a multiple multicast time-shifted content delivery mode, the mode comprising delivering the piece of content using a plurality of multicast streams, the plurality of multicast streams each delivering the content with a relative time-shift between corresponding portions of the content; wherein the determination is based on at least one of;
a measure of the number of requests for the content in a preceding time period;a model of predicted requests for the content in a subsequent time period;a determination of the geographical or topological distribution of the existing or expected destinations in the network;the topological or geographical position of the requesting destination in the content delivery network compared to the position of other destinations already receiving the content; anda measure of the network capacity or availability between the source and the at least one destination. |
